Senior Technical Analyst- Network Automation Engineer

Location: IN - Bangalore | Job-ID: 218978 | Contract type: Standard | Business Unit: IT Consulting


Life on the team


Computacenter India is looking for an energetic and enthusiastic Senior Network Engineer with strong core networking expertise and a proven network automation background. The role combines traditional Level 3 network operations with Dev/NetOps ways of working to reduce manual effort, improve consistency, accelerate change delivery and strengthen service reliability.The successful candidate will support and improve critical network infrastructure across global Computacenter offices, while actively building reusable


What you'll do



  • Adopt an automation-first mindset: identify repetitive, high-volume or high-risk operational activities and convert them into repeatable automation workflows.

  • Develop, maintain and improve network automation scripts, playbooks and workflows using Python, Ansible and REST APIs for activities such as configuration backup, compliance checks, pre/post-change validation, reporting and standard changes.

  • Apply Infrastructure as Code principles to network configuration and operational artefacts, ensuring changes are version-controlled, peer-reviewed, tested and reusable.

  • Support CI/CD for network changes by contributing to automated validation, linting, configuration testing, approval gates and controlled deployment pipelines before production rollout.

  • Create reusable templates and self-service network capabilities for standard, pre-approved operational requests where appropriate.

  • Use source-of-truth data, structured data formats and automation-friendly inventory models to improve accuracy, consistency and auditability.

  • Build automated health checks, drift detection, compliance reporting and reliability controls to reduce operational risk and improve proactive monitoring.

  • Collaborate with operations, engineering and tooling teams to embed backlog-driven delivery, Kanban ways of working and continuous improvement into network operations.


What you'll need



  • 7 to 12 years of relevant experience in managing critical enterprise network infrastructure across routing, switching, firewalls, wireless, WAN/LAN and datacentre technologies.

  • Minimum 3 to 5 years of hands-on network automation experience in operations, engineering or delivery environments.

  • Bachelor’s degree in technology, engineering or equivalent practical experience.

  • CCNA or CCNP certification is desired; equivalent hands-on experience will also be considered.

  • Experience in project deployment or operational transformation activities such as SD-WAN rollouts, datacentre network changes, firewall migrations, wireless upgrades or automation-led operational improvements is an advantage.

  • Experience with network source-of-truth platforms such as NetBox or equivalent inventory-driven automation approaches.

  • Exposure to observability, event enrichment, automated remediation or AIOps concepts for network operations.

  • Experience building dashboards or operational reports from automation outputs and monitoring data.

  • Understanding of secure automation practices, credential management, secrets handling and audit-friendly change controls.

  • Experience working with Agile/Kanban backlogs for operational improvement and product-aligned service delivery.
